Decoding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are often the most misunderstood aspect of casino bonuses. They represent the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out. It's vital to calculate the total wagering required, taking into account both the bonus amount and the initial deposit. Furthermore, different games contribute differently to fulfilling the wagering requirement; sl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ute a smaller percentage. Carefully reviewing these details before accepting a bonus is essential to avoid disappointment.
